Hi I hope someone really can help me on my current housing matter. I am married for 2 years and currently I am holding the ownership together with my mum who is a retiree for my current flat which I bought (transfer of ownership) from my father 10 years ago. But now I intend to buy a new flat together with my wife and there is current outstanding mortgage loan of 160k with ocbc. So now my question is will I be able to transfer this flat back to my father's name? If anyone willing to help I can provide more details. Thank you.

Good morning Rajini,

It will be best to approach your HDB branch office on this matter directly.

If you wish to transfer the ownership back to your father, both of your parents must be able to take over your share in terms of loan and CPF OA funds utilised.

If not, it will be a mission impossible.

Alternatively you may wish to sell current flat and purchase a bigger house which you will include your parents in the ownership.

Hi Rajini,

If your dad is no longer working, its unlikely the bank will allow the transfer as it be difficult for him to service the current loan. He also needs to refund the CPF OA you have utilized for the property so you can exit ownership. You might want to consider buying a bigger flat to house everyone.

Hi Rajini,

In order to pass the ownership back to your father, your father will have to have the ability to undertake the outstanding loan based on his age and income. Also he will have to refund back to your CPF-OA all the monies that you have paid towards your current house.

Have you worked out your financials? Because one option you can consider is a dual-key unit, where your families can stay next to each other.
